Start your trip in Lucknow by immersing yourself in the peaceful surroundings of the Bada Imambara in the morning. This grand architectural marvel is famous for its intricate design and sprawling gardens. Spend the afternoon at Indira Gandhi Planetarium, an ideal place to relax and explore the wonders of the universe through its various exhibits and shows. In the evening, stroll along the scenic banks of Gomti River and enjoy the beautiful view of the illuminated cityscape.
